Good summer job
The Payless I worked at was in a mall, so that made it even busy at times. We had to be open on all the holidays because it was in a mall. You’re on your feet all day, yes you do get lunch and a break but still its demanding on your feet and plus you would sometimes have to climb up ladders to get shoes from the top. The customers weren't that bad, most of time you would get nice people who don't want to give you a hard time.Sales Associate/Key Holder in London, ON

No
My experience with Payless was that the management uses lower staff to do all the duties they don’t want to do. Things such as running shipment, presentation changes, sale changes, etc. Very micromanaged at this company. And no chance of advancing after almost 2 years without having to relocate. Not for a retail job! Also only received 30% discount which was less than customers discounts half the time. What would you say about your employer?
